What is NS3 GUI HELPER ?
NS-3 GUI Helper is an innovative software tool designed to streamline the process of network simulation using NS-3 (Network Simulator 3) by providing an intuitive graphical user interface (GUI). NS-3 is renowned for its accuracy and flexibility in modelling complex network scenarios, but its command-line interface can present challenges for novice users.
NS-3 GUI Helper addresses this issue by offering a user-friendly interface that simplifies simulation setup, configuration, and visualization in early stage of learning process for NS-3. Whether you are a student, professor or a master of a NS-3 this software might help you to write efficient code, minimal error and it can save your time for writing code for basic scenarios.

How to get started using NS3 GUI HELPER?
Currently, The latest release of this is v1.2.0 for more details you can visit here. Let's say you want to start using that application to learn NS3 or there may be another reason, then, in that case, you can just go to GitHub's latest release section and from there you can download ".zip" file which will contains ".jar" file for appliocation and user manul.
Step-1 : Go to this URL and find out the release with the latest label in green color.
From the latest release section, you can download the ".zip" file that has name same as that of the version. (e.g. v1.2.0.zip)
There may be other ".zip" file although, they are containing the code of the application which may be not needed for someone who want to use the application.
After download, extract that ".zip" file and follow Step-2
Step-2 : After extraction, you'll find the ".jar" file and user manual. You can read the user manual and start using that application.
